Jack Dunn, FTI Consulting's President and CEO, Headlines Consulting magazine's Top 25 Consultants for 2012

(firmenpresse) - NEW YORK, NY -- (Marketwire) -- 05/21/12 -- Jack Dunn, President and CEO of FTI Consulting since 1995, has helped guide it from a small forensic consulting firm into one of the largest global business advisory firms, maintaining a compound annual growth rate in excess of 30 percent. "The journey of a little company from $6 million in revenue in Annapolis, Maryland in 1995 to a $1.6 billion worldwide firm has been an unbelievable one for me to witness," Dunn says.
When he joined the company, it had just 75 employees and two locations. Today it has 3,800 professionals in more than 50 offices in 24 countries. Since Dunn took over, FTI's fingerprints have been all over some of the biggest news stories of the day -- including the O.J. Simpson trial, the Milosevic war crimes trials, the Major League Baseball steroid investigation, the 2000 presidential election recount, as well as Enron and Bernie Madoff.
In addition to Mr. Dunn, the Top 25 Consultants of 2012 are comprised of professionals from leading consultancies, including: Accenture, A.T. Kearney, Bain & Company, The Boston Consulting Group, Deloitte Consulting, Ernst & Young, IBM, KPMG, Mercer, North Highland and PwC, among others. "We were incredibly impressed with the nearly 500 nominations we received this year. Each year, the Top 25 nominations get stronger, and this year we heard from a lot more clients than we normally do, which is fantastic," says Consulting Editor & Publisher, Joe Kornik. "It looks like we're finally turning the corner and companies are tired of trying to cost cut their way to success. Instead they are investing again, and they are turning to consultants to help them grow."
The Top 25 Consultants were recognized in the following areas: Leadership, Client Service, Healthcare, Financial Services, Public Sector, Energy and Technology.
